New Faces Take Their Places in Easttown
Two supervisors and a new auditor are sworn in in Easttown.

Two members of the Easttown Board of Supervisors and a new auditor were sworn in to office Tuesday night during a special organizational meeting of the board.
Richard Frazier was re-elected in November and took the oath of office, administered by District Justice Thomas Tartaglio. Frazier was also appointed the new Chairman in a unanomous vote by the Board of Supervisors.
Fred Pioggia was sworn in for his first term on the board. Benson Goldberg also took the oath of office as a member of the township's Board of Auditors.

After a brief swearing in, it was down to business in as the Easttown supervisors officially appointed other officials of the township government. Mike Brown was officially named Township Manager, replacing Gene Williams who retired last week after 40 years of service to the township.
David Obzud was officially reappointed Chief of Police. Andrew Rau was reappointed Easttown Township Solicitor and The ARRO Group was oficially named the township's Consulting Engineer. Their appointments were formalities required by law.
